Hello,



I recently discovered NFB Blind Crafters/Krafters Korner and have been exploring the tremendous amount of practical knowledge your community has developed around accessible crafting.

I’m developing the Textile Access Pilot, an initiative examining accessibility throughout knitting, crochet, loom knitting, and other textile crafts. The project looks beyond individual adaptive tools to the complete crafting experience: pattern accessibility, tactile and nonvisual instruction, yarn identification and organization, workspace setup, dexterity, cognitive accessibility, equipment, and independent participation



I also run Uglier Than Homemade Sin, an adaptive fiber arts project centered on accessible and beginner-friendly crafting.



I am especially interested in learning from blind crafters rather than assuming that sighted designers, manufacturers, or accessibility professionals can determine what people need on their own. Some of the most innovative solutions I have encountered have been developed within the blind crafting community itself.



I would love to connect with someone from NFB Blind Crafters about the barriers your members encounter, adaptations that have proven particularly useful, and what you wish yarn, tool, pattern, and craft companies understood about accessibility.



If there is interest, I would also be glad to explore ways the Textile Access Pilot could support your work through resource sharing, accessible product evaluation, community feedback, or future collaboration.



Thank you for creating a place where blind crafters can share, learn, and teach.
